NBC Going After Arena Football
NBC is finalizing a deal to secure broadcasting rights to Arena Football League games, beginning next season, The Times has confirmed.
The deal, which is expected to be announced next week, is the latest attempt to attract male viewers to a network that in the last five years has lost broadcast rights to Major League Baseball and the NFL. NBC will lose its NBA rights at the end of this season.
The arena league’s soon-to-be completed deal with NBC was first reported in Friday’s edition of the Newark (N.J.) Star-Ledger.
